Every technician we send to a Elizabethtown property completes IICRC water damage restoration training (WRT) at minimum, with many holding advanced applied structural drying (ASD) certification as well. That training covers psychrometry, structural drying science, and the safe handling of contaminated water categories — not just how to run a pump.

After years of responding to Elizabethtown proper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Elizabethtown property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Heavy storms, wind-driven rain, and aging roofing materials all contribute to water intrusion in Elizabethtown homes and businesses, especially in older roof systems nearing the end of their lifespan.
Clogged municipal lines, tree root intrusion, and sump pump failures can send contaminated water back into Elizabethtown basements and lower levels, requiring specialized cleanup and sanitizing.
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ers, and HVAC condensation lines are common — and often overlooked — sources of slow leaks that eventually cause significant damage in Elizabethtown properties if left unnoticed.
Poor drainage patterns are a frequent contributor to recurring water issues in Elizabethtown basements, especially in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ping and settled soil.
After a fire is out, the water used to fight it often causes its own separate restoration need across affected Elizabethtown floors and rooms, sometimes worse than the fire itself.

A shop vac and a few fans can make a Elizabethtown property look dry on the surface — but "looks dry" and "is actually dry" are two very different things.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Elizabethtown hom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Elizabethtown hom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
If the water was minor, contained, and cleaned up within an hour or two, DIY handling is often fine. Once it's soaked into materials or sat for any real length of time, though, a professional assessment is the safer move for your Elizabethtown property.
The minutes before our Elizabethtown cr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
A quick photo record of standing water and affected belongings makes the insurance process smoother down the line.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
